Output 24223faec50899635d841ae482d6c5d75c31caf744ec9deb2637f1e357336722:56

value
106020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db34eb499417188f601ea21ffe7508cc98127c7 OP_EQUAL
address
3EcG16FkpHLrzkfxpFD3DAC2kbUPt22Hmi
transaction
24223faec50899635d841ae482d6c5d75c31caf744ec9deb2637f1e357336722
confirmations
217806
spent
true